Multiple choice

Which type of paint is made from pigments suspended in oil?

  1. Acrylic Paint

  2. Watercolor Paint

  3. Oil Paint

  4. Gouache

Reveal answer Fill a bubble to check yourself
C Correct answer
Explanation

Oil Paint is made from pigments suspended in oil, typically linseed oil, and is known for its slow drying time and rich, vibrant colors.
